How Can I Get a Job in Indian Railways?
Getting a job in Indian Railways follows a clear and well-defined recruitment process handled by the Railway Recruitment Board (RRB) and Railway Recruitment Cell (RRC).
Step-by-Step Process
- Keep an eye on official railway job notifications
- Choose the post that matches your qualification
- Apply online through RRB or RRC websites
- Clear the written exam and physical test (if required)
- Pass document verification and medical test
Indian Railways recruits for Group A, B, C, and D posts, which means opportunities are available for candidates ranging from 10th pass to graduates.
What Qualifications Are Required for Indian Railway Jobs?

Indian Railways offers jobs for almost every educational background.
Jobs Based on Minimum Qualification
- 10th Pass: Track Maintainer, Helper, Pointsman
- 12th Pass: Clerk, Ticket Collector, Apprentice
- ITI Holders: Technician, Junior Engineer
- Graduates: Station Master, NTPC posts, Officer-level roles

Which Exams Are Conducted for Indian Railway Recruitment?

Indian Railways conducts several competitive exams every year to fill vacancies across departments.
Major Railway Exams
- RRB NTPC: Clerk, Station Master, Goods Guard
- RRB Group D: Track Maintainer, Helper
- RRB ALP: Assistant Loco Pilot
- RRB JE: Junior Engineer
- RRC Apprentice: For ITI candidates

What Is the Age Limit to Apply for Indian Railway Jobs?
Age limits depend on the post and category you apply for.
General Age Criteria
- Group D: 18–33 years
- NTPC (Undergraduate): 18–30 years
- NTPC (Graduate): 18–33 years
Age Relaxation
- SC/ST: 5 years
- OBC: 3 years
- Ex-Servicemen & PwBD: As per government rules

What Is the Selection Process for Indian Railway Jobs?
The railway selection process is transparent and completely merit-based.
Selection Stages
- Computer Based Test (CBT)
- Physical Efficiency Test (PET) for Group D posts
- Skill Test or Typing Test (if applicable)
- Document Verification
- Medical Examination
The final merit list is prepared based on exam performance and reservation rules.
What Is the Salary of Indian Railway Employees?
One of the biggest reasons candidates prefer railways is the attractive salary under the 7th Pay Commission.
Salary Overview
- Group D: ₹18,000 – ₹22,000
- NTPC Clerk: ₹25,000 – ₹30,000
- Station Master: ₹35,000 – ₹45,000
- Assistant Loco Pilot: ₹40,000 – ₹55,000
- Junior Engineer: ₹45,000 – ₹60,000
Extra Benefits
- Dearness Allowance (DA), HRA, TA
- Free railway passes
- Medical facilities for family
- Pension under NPS
